If anyone hasn't tried sous vide egg bites here's an easy recipe : 6 - 4oz Mason jelly jars 6 large eggs 1/2 cup cottage cheese 1/2 cup shredded cheese (sharp cheddar/swiss/gruyere etc) 1 tbs diced shallot (optional) 1 tsp salt 1/2 tsp pepper 1 tsp dried herbs... I like a parsley/chives/tarragon (go very easy on tarragon) mixture. Mix all thoroughly in a blender. You really need a blender to get the smooth consistency. Spray or grease the jars (a must) with the fat/oil of your choice. After filling jars only tighten the lids until you feel resistance. This allows steam to escape. Sous Vide at 168 F for one hour. To remove from jar run a butter knife around the edge and invert onto a plate. These are great warm or cold. You can also add a small piece of cooked bacon to the bottom of the jar before filling as a bonus. 🤘. These refrigerate well and you can heat them up right in the jar (lid removed of course) in your microwave for 30 seconds. Make a batch and have them all week in short order.

the last steer we bought we requested they vacuum seal all the cuts in the sealed plastic bags rather than wrapping in butcher's paper. they all have labels marking what they are. so a little hot water and a few seconds to remove the label and I pop this original bag into my sous vide unit. saves a tone of time when buying beef in bulk to have it sealed rather than wrapped. costs a tad more for this but i never need to refreeze or handle the beef until I am ready to cook it.

I've been using it the last few days to do low temp pasteurization and canning of the peppers coming out of my garden. The cool thing about using sous vide (vs traditional canning) is that you can really easily scale it. I can do a single jar in a pot of water or I can do dozens in a big Igloo cooler.
